The Elusive Answer: Why Dora’s Height is Debated
Unlocking the mystery of Dora’s height is no easy feat. A primary reason for the ambiguity is the inherent nature of cartoon characters. They’re often drawn with exaggerated features and proportions, prioritizing visual appeal and comedic effect over strict realism. Dora is no exception. Her large eyes, simplified features, and overall design are all tailored to captivate a young audience. In this context, precise measurements and realistic scale aren’t always a priority.
Furthermore, as mentioned earlier, there’s no official statement or data from the creators regarding Dora’s height. Nickelodeon hasn’t released any information that would definitively settle the debate, leaving fans and curious onlookers to rely on their own observations and calculations.
Another challenge arises from the visual inconsistencies within the show itself. Dora’s size relative to other characters and objects can vary slightly from scene to scene, making accurate estimations difficult. What appears to be a consistent scale in one episode might subtly shift in another, further complicating the process of pinpointing her true height. The background environment may also be ambiguous, with no clear reference points to accurately use.
Analyzing Visual Comparisons: Estimating Dora’s Height
In the absence of official data, visual comparisons offer a valuable avenue for estimating Dora’s height. By carefully observing her interactions with other characters and objects within the show, we can begin to piece together a more informed assessment.
Let’s consider her relationship with Boots, her beloved monkey companion. Boots is significantly smaller than Dora, but how much smaller? To answer that, we must first have a baseline size to compare him to. Depending on the species, monkeys can be very different sizes, but looking at common species like capuchin monkeys, we can estimate Boots’ height when standing upright to be around one foot to one foot six inches. Dora appears to be roughly two to three times the size of Boots, placing her estimated height between three feet and four feet six inches.

Beyond Height: Dora’s Impact and Legacy
While the question of Dora’s height may be a fun and engaging puzzle to solve, it’s crucial to remember that her true significance lies far beyond mere inches. Dora the Explorer has made a lasting impact on children’s programming, offering a valuable blend of entertainment and education.
One of Dora’s most notable contributions is her promotion of bilingualism. Through her interactions with her friends and the audience, she introduces children to basic Spanish vocabulary and encourages language learning from a young age. This exposure to another language can broaden children’s horizons, foster cultural understanding, and even improve their cognitive abilities.
Furthermore, Dora consistently demonstrates strong problem-solving skills. Throughout her adventures, she encounters various challenges and obstacles, which she tackles with creativity, resourcefulness, and the help of her friends. By observing Dora’s approach to problem-solving, children can learn valuable skills for navigating their own challenges and developing critical thinking abilities.
